type ClientConnection ¶
type ClientConnection struct {
ConnectionID string
Request *networkservice.NetworkServiceRequest
Xcon *crossconnect.CrossConnect
RemoteNsm *registry.NetworkServiceManager
Endpoint *registry.NSERegistration
ForwarderRegisteredName string
ConnectionState ClientConnectionState
ForwarderState ForwarderState
Span spanhelper.SpanHelper
Monitor connectionmonitor.MonitorServer
}
ClientConnection struct in model that describes cross connect between NetworkServiceClient and NetworkServiceEndpoint
func (*ClientConnection) GetConnectionDestination ¶
func (cc *ClientConnection) GetConnectionDestination() *connection.Connection
GetConnectionDestination returns destination part of connection
func (*ClientConnection) GetConnectionSource ¶
func (cc *ClientConnection) GetConnectionSource() *connection.Connection
GetConnectionSource returns source part of connection
func (*ClientConnection) GetID ¶
func (cc *ClientConnection) GetID() string
GetID returns id of clientConnection
func (*ClientConnection) GetNetworkService ¶
func (cc *ClientConnection) GetNetworkService() string
GetNetworkService returns name of networkService of clientConnection
type ClientConnectionState ¶
type ClientConnectionState int8
ClientConnectionState describes state of ClientConnection
const ( // ClientConnectionReady means connection is in state 'ready' ClientConnectionReady ClientConnectionState = 0 // ClientConnectionRequesting means connection - is trying to be established for first time. ClientConnectionRequesting ClientConnectionState = 1 // ClientConnectionBroken means connection failed requesting ClientConnectionBroken ClientConnectionState = 2 // ClientConnectionHealingBegin means connection - is trying to be updated or to be healed. ClientConnectionHealingBegin ClientConnectionState = 3 // ClientConnectionHealing means connection - is in progress of being updated or to be healed. ClientConnectionHealing ClientConnectionState = 4 // ClientConnectionClosing means connection is started closing process ClientConnectionClosing ClientConnectionState = 5 )

type ForwarderState ¶
type ForwarderState int8
ForwarderState describes state of forwarder
const ( // ForwarderStateNone means there is no active connection in forwarder ForwarderStateNone ForwarderState = 0 // In case forwarder is not yet configured for connection // ForwarderStateReady means there is an active connection in forwarder ForwarderStateReady ForwarderState = 1 // In case forwarder is configured for connection. )
type Listener ¶
type Listener interface {
EndpointAdded(ctx context.Context, endpoint *Endpoint)
EndpointUpdated(ctx context.Context, endpoint *Endpoint)
EndpointDeleted(ctx context.Context, endpoint *Endpoint)
ForwarderAdded(ctx context.Context, forwarder *Forwarder)
ForwarderDeleted(ctx context.Context, forwarder *Forwarder)
ClientConnectionAdded(ctx context.Context, clientConnection *ClientConnection)
ClientConnectionDeleted(ctx context.Context, clientConnection *ClientConnection)
ClientConnectionUpdated(ctx context.Context, old, new *ClientConnection)
}
Listener represent an interface for listening model changes
type ListenerImpl ¶
type ListenerImpl struct{}
ListenerImpl is empty implementation of Listener
